It perhaps strengthens Tony's argument, that
Angel doubts Tess's guilt until the moment of
arrest, that the sentence he quotes- 'Her story
then was true!' - was an addition to the
manuscript, as if TH was himself mulling over the
issue. Similarly, in Ch 57, 'By degrees he was
inclined to believe that she had faintly
attempted, at least, what she said she had
done...' is a revision in the ms of the earlier
and less qualified ''By degrees he grew...'. This
might well be an issue Hardy discussed with
someone like Francis Jeune, QC: according to the
Life he was at a party at the Jeunes' in March
1891, when putting ''the finishing touches' to
Tess, but he stayed there so often Lord Rowton
called him their 'dosser'.
In support of Chuck's very helpful message, one
might also quote (ch 57): 'neither one of them
seemed to consider any question of effectual
escape, disguise, or long concealment. Their
every idea was temporary and unforefending,like
the plans of two children.' (At one stage the ms
had 'dreams' rather than 'plans'.)
So far as Clare does offer a plan, it is only to
walk inland, where they are 'less likely to be
looked for' than nearer the coast, with the
thought that 'Later on ... we can make for some
port'. This, at most, is to imagine making a
plan, rather than actually to make one. Just
before the arrest, however, he does look round
for a stone or other weapon; fortunately for him
he doesn't find one, so there is no question
resisting arrest, or trying to stop the police
arresting Tess. I think he is legally safe -
though he has been sentenced in retrospect by
generations of readers of the novel....
